summaryrefslogtreecommitdiff
path: root/source3/script/tests
diff options
context:
space:
mode:
authorSamuel Cabrero <scabrero@suse.de>2018-08-31 18:27:50 +0200
committerNoel Power <npower@samba.org>2018-12-19 12:42:12 +0100
commit3794c1c5274f88c32fa8937b92f30a1308d57bb0 (patch)
tree35d2454aa6f69a72b3ce20c44ad82c51fd75bd74 /source3/script/tests
parentdfa149276f1e2c1a64208ff33ca161008f012d6d (diff)
downloadsamba-3794c1c5274f88c32fa8937b92f30a1308d57bb0.tar.gz
tests/ntlm_auth: Port ntlm_auth tests to python: ntlm_auth plaintext authentication with failed require-membership-of
Port ntlm_auth bash script tests to python Signed-off-by: Samuel Cabrero <scabrero@suse.de> Reviewed-by: Noel Power <npower@samba.org>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Diffstat (limited to 'source3/script/tests')
-rwxr-xr-xsource3/script/tests/test_ntlm_auth_s3.sh33
1 files changed, 0 insertions, 33 deletions
diff --git a/source3/script/tests/test_ntlm_auth_s3.sh b/source3/script/tests/test_ntlm_auth_s3.sh
index 2a4942bb9f5..56e327c8ec2 100755
--- a/source3/script/tests/test_ntlm_auth_s3.sh
+++ b/source3/script/tests/test_ntlm_auth_s3.sh
@@ -24,37 +24,6 @@ BADSID=`eval $BINDIR/wbinfo -n $USERNAME | cut -d ' ' -f1 | sed 's/..$//'`
failed=0
-test_plaintext_check_output_fail()
-{
- tmpfile=$PREFIX/ntlm_commands
-
- cat > $tmpfile <<EOF
-$DOMAIN\\$USERNAME $PASSWORD
-EOF
- cmd='$NTLM_AUTH "$@" --require-membership-of=$BADSID --helper-protocol=squid-2.5-basic < $tmpfile 2>&1'
- eval echo "$cmd"
- out=`eval $cmd`
- ret=$?
- rm -f $tmpfile
-
- if [ $ret != 0 ] ; then
- echo "$out"
- echo "command failed"
- false
- return
- fi
-
- echo "$out" | grep "ERR" >/dev/null 2>&1
-
- if [ $? = 0 ] ; then
- # failed to authenticate .. success
- true
- else
- echo "incorrectly gave a successful authentication"
- false
- fi
-}
-
test_ntlm_server_1_check_output()
{
tmpfile=$PREFIX/ntlm_commands
@@ -238,8 +207,6 @@ EOF
}
# This should work even with NTLMv2
-testit "ntlm_auth plaintext authentication with failed require-membership-of" test_plaintext_check_output_fail || failed=`expr $failed + 1`
-
testit "ntlm_auth ntlm-server-1 with fixed password" test_ntlm_server_1_check_output || failed=`expr $failed + 1`
testit "ntlm_auth ntlm-server-1 with incorrect fixed password" test_ntlm_server_1_check_output_fail || failed=`expr $failed + 1`
testit "ntlm_auth ntlm-server-1 with plaintext password against winbind" test_ntlm_server_1_check_winbind_output || failed=`expr $failed + 1`